I'm looking for the beam (gunwale to gunwale) measurement at the point on the boat where the thwarts are.

The original thwarts that came with the boat were rotting and split at the screws, so I made new ones. I simply duplicated their length and the location of the attachments, including the fact that they don't quite reach from the seats inward to the centerboard housing, falling short by about 1/2". Now I'm thinking that they should actually butt up against the housing, meaning that the gunwales ought to be a little closer together.

The fact that they are too far apart is the reason why the supporting tabs are coming loose!

So if someone has nice, intact, DSI with original thwarts jammed nicely into place against the centerboard trunk, please measure your gunwale-to-gunwale beam right where the thwarts are. I can then check this measurement against what I have and squeeze things up a bit when I put in a new thwart support.
